Incremental rebuilds on Quillpress are skipping pages whose upstream data changed but whose source files didn't. Cause: the content hash ignores remote fetch results. Workaround: trigger a full rebuild via the dashboard; takes ~9 min. Don't clear the CDN cache first — it just extends the stale window. Fix is in review; it adds fetch digests to the hash input. If a customer reports stale pages after a full rebuild, escalate to the platform rotation. Include the build token printed below when you file it.

pipeline stamp: htk31_f769b577b3028a4e9958e5bb8d1259a

Handover — Pool Car Key Cabinet (Meridel House)

Hi Tansa, before I head off: the key cabinet by the loading bay now holds all six pool car fobs. Please log every sign-out in the red folder, and check fuel cards are returned with the keys. The cabinet relocks automatically after two minutes. Use the code below to open it.

door code, yagap-bahof: bdg-O-05

Alert: ReportSortInstabilityDetected. The nightly consistency check for the Thistledown report builder found rows with equal sort keys appearing in different orders across consecutive runs. This usually means a non-stable sort was introduced in a recent change, or a tiebreaker column was dropped. Exported reports may differ between runs, which breaks downstream diff tooling. Please do not acknowledge without investigating. Triage steps and the expected tiebreaker configuration are described on the internal page.

dashboard of bawif-bagug = https://jira.lumicsys.internal/display/browse/display/6135ac61

Subject: Kiosk watchdog cut-over complete

Team,

Cut-over of the Lanternbox kiosk watchdog finished at 03:10. All 42 kiosks on the new Sentry-Loop agent; old pulse daemon disabled. Two units in the Marrow Street lobby needed manual reboots, now green. Heartbeat interval tightened, auto-restart verified on three forced crashes. No rollback triggers hit. For the record, the fleet is now running with these values.

deployment values, faduf-tawep:
SORDOR_LOG_LEVEL=error
SORDOR_METRICS_HOST=metrics.sordor.nelvrolabs.internal
SORDOR_POOL_SIZE=4